Commuters Asked to Carpool, Get Dropped Off in Cranford
Commuters are being asked to be dropped off or carpool to the train station for Tuesday, Jan. 26

Cranford, NJ -- Commuters are being asked to be dropped off or carpool to the train station for Tuesday, Jan. 26 until the snow be removed from the upper levels of the parking garage and all municipal parking lots.
Due to significant snow load and plowing operations, the town of Cranford announced it has been forced to close the upper level for the next few days. Parking will also be limited in all municipal lots.
“Commuters that cannot find a parking spot in the 12 hour permit parking lots may utilize any parking spaces in the parking garage on Tuesday without penalty,” Cranford Police reported. “This does not include the spaces marked for the private residences of Cranford Crossing.”

An update will be sent on Tuesday evening as to whether this will carry over to Wednesday.
